Originariamente inviato da ivox
posso cambiare live da varchar a int o mi perde tutti i dati?
Se sono tutti valori numerici puoi cambiare da varchar a int con un alter table.

In ogni caso come regola generale prima di fare modifiche con il rischio di perdere dei dati si deve eseguire un backup della tabella, poi fai una copia della tabella (anche parziale) e provi su quella. Se la modifica funziona allora la esegui sulla tabella reale e rifai un backup per avere i dati aggiornati mantenendo sempre una copia di backup n-1.

Eccessivo? forse, almeno fino a quando non scoprirai di avere perso tutti i dati ed allora ringraziera il S. Culone da backup .... (ora pro nobis)....
.